Everybody knows that the future is vegan, but it can also be a grand adventure right now. On the Main Street Vegan Podcast, bestselling author and vegan OG Victoria Moran invites you to be in on conversations with the best and brightest in this space. You'll hear from physicians, philosophers, activists, athletes, chefs and celebrities on eating and living for optimum health, while protecting the planet and saving the lives and ending the suffering of animals. Why Aren’t Doctors Taught Nutrition? Dr. Michael Klaper on Fixing Medicine 26.03.2026 56:35
Dr. Michael Klaper shares what 50 years in medicine have taught him: most chronic disease is preventable—and often reversible—with diet. Now through his nonprofit, Moving Medicine Forward , he’s working to bring nutrition education into medical schools. A hopeful, eye-opening conversation on food, health, and the future of medicine.

Dr. Neal Barnard on the New Dietary Guidelines 13.01.2026 35:28
Nutrition science took a massive hit with the January 7th release of the 2026 Dietary Guideline for Americans, recommending increased consumption of meat, eggs, and dairy (while, impossibly, keeping saturated fat low).
